Ways to pay less — or nothing

Most Putnam Valley homeowners qualify for at least one of these programs. We help you apply at no cost.

Grant

VA HISA Grant

Up to $6,800 for service-connected veterans and their surviving spouses. One-time, tax-free, no repayment.

Eligibility: Veterans & surviving spouses
Waiver

New York Medicaid Waiver

Home & Community-Based Services Waiver may cover up to 100% of installation for income-qualified residents.

Eligibility: Medicaid + medical need
Tax deduction

IRS Medical Deduction

With a doctor's letter of medical necessity, the full cost is deductible on Schedule A as a qualified medical expense.

Eligibility: Taxpayers who itemize

What does a stairlift cost in Putnam Valley, NY?

Straight models start at $2,800 installed. Curved lifts, custom-bent to match your landings and turns, begin at $9,000. Outdoor weatherproof models start at $4,000, and heavy-duty lifts rated to 600 lb start at $5,050. Every quote includes the on-site measurement, rail, seat, installation, and a 5-year warranty plus lifetime rail coverage. Financing runs from about $79 a month.

Why do curved stairlifts cost more than straight ones in Putnam Valley?

A curved lift is custom-manufactured for your exact staircase. Luis laser-measures every turn and landing on-site, then the factory bends the rail to match. That process takes roughly three weeks and is why a curved rail costs more — but it fits perfectly with no gaps and no wall modifications, which matters in the landing-turn staircases around Roaring Brook Lake.

Does insurance cover stairlift costs in Putnam County?

Original Medicare does not cover stairlifts. Residents enrolled in New York's Nursing Home Transition and Diversion (NHTD) Medicaid waiver may have a stairlift covered as an environmental modification through their care manager. Veterans can apply for the VA's HISA grant — up to $6,800 for service-connected disabilities. New York's Access to Home for Heroes program can also fund accessibility work for income-qualified veterans through local administrators.

Is financing available for a Putnam Valley stairlift?

Yes. Financing starts at $79 a month. The application takes about five minutes online or by phone, and most approvals come back within an hour. There's no prepayment penalty, so paying it off early costs nothing extra. Many Putnam Valley families simply split the cost among siblings.
